Saint Vincent DePaul
By St Mary Administrator @ 10:08 AM :: 241 Views :: Article Rating :: Church News
 
In November and December we made 27 home visits. Most visits were in response to calls for help with WE energy bill or rent. During 1 visit we determined that help would be inappropriate. One involved supportive conversation only. Two others were in response to an immediate need for a tank of gas. Four were for furniture and 2 for clothing from our store. All others were either rent or WE energy costs. We wrote checks for slightly over $2,300 and Salvation Army vouchers for $1,850. January has continued in a similar vein. Today, February 2, we’ll visit a man in an empty apartment; we’ll put some furniture in it for him. So it goes, month after month, year after year. We see Jesus in the eyes of the poor. Each visit is a humbling and sometimes emotional experience.
